Facebook continues to grow in Canada

TORONTO (PGN) >> Facebook is the fourth most popular website in Canada, according to statistics released today.

The social networking site had 14.4 million visitors in October, up from 13.8 million in September, comScore Media Metrix reports. A year ago, Facebook had about 1 million Canadian visitors.

Microsoft sites are in the top spot, attracting 22.2 million visitors last month. Google and Yahoo! follow with 22 million and 16.8 million respectively. In fifth spot is eBay, with 13.9 million visitors.

Time Warner Network, Wikipedia, Yellow Pages, Amazon and Canoe also made the list of the top 10 Internet properties in Canada.

The statistics compiled by comScore do not include sites accessed through mobile devices or at public terminals like Internet cafes.

The biggest growth in October happened at NHL Network sites, which grew 44 percent from September to 3.9 million visitors. Video site Crackle.com helped Sony Online jump 27 percent to 2.6 million.
